*The gameplay closely replicates that of Blizzard's own card battler, ''Hearthstone: Heroes of Warcraft.'' Naturally, several differences are present to make this game its own.
 
**Hearthstone only has 9 hero classes (6 of which have alternate but functionally identical heroes), as opposed to PvZH's 10 heroes per team, resulting in a total of 20 playable heroes.
 
**Each Hearthstone class has access to its own set of cards and a large set of Neutral cards, rather than having access to 2 sets of class cards.
 
**Hearthstone heroes have 30 health (with the exception of cards that replace your Hero) rather than 20 health. Hearthstone also has an Armor system (adds additional health to your hero with certain cards; can exceed maximum health) which may have inspired the Super-Block meter.
 
**Hearthstone contains 7 minion types similar to the several card tribes in PvZH.
 
**Teammates in PvZH are known as Minions in Hearthstone. Similarly, Tricks are known as Spells.
 
**Each match begins with both players having 1 currency maximum and gaining 1 currency as turns go by. However, Hearthstone has a maximum of 10 Mana, as opposed to PvZH's indefinite maximum Sun/Brains.
 
**Several card effects appear under different names in both games.
 
***Teammates with '''When played''' have '''Battlecry.'''
 
***Teammates with '''When destroyed''' have '''Deathrattle.'''
 
***Teammates with '''Frenzy''' have a modified version of '''Windfury.'''
 
***Teammates or tricks with '''Freeze''' also have '''Freeze.'''
 
***Teammates with '''Can't be hurt''' have '''Immune.'''
 
**Several PvZH card effects are also not present, but may have been inspired by, some in Hearthstone.
 
***Teammates with '''Armored''' or '''Team-Up''' may have been inspired by '''Taunt''' (which forces minions to attack it first).
 
***Teammates that give extra Sun/Brains may have been inspired by similar Druid class cards.
 
**Several cards in PvZH are inspired by those in Hearthstone.
 
***For example, [[Soul Patch]] functions similarly to Bolf Ramshield, in that both cards take damage for your hero while it is present on the battlefield.
 
**Signature Superpowers are known as Hero Powers and function differently in Hearthstone. Hero Powers cost 2 Mana and can be used once per turn.

Plants vs. Zombies Heroes is a collectible mobile card game announced on March 10, 2016, through PopCap Games' official YouTube channel and soft released in certain countries on the same day. It is set to be fully released later in 2016, but no concrete date was given.

Gameplay

The main objective of this game is to defeat the opposing side Hero by reducing its health to 0. That is done via the cards played on the field. There are two types of cards: Fighters (Plants/Zombies) and Tricks.

  • Fighters are cards that stay on the field until destroyed. They all have three stats: Strength (StrengthPvZH); Health (HeartPvZH) and Cost (SunPvZH/BrainPvZH), plus some have special abilities that can't be ignored and makes each one unique. The player must know how to use those in their favor in order to win against tougher opponents.
    In the battle phase, each one attacks. The strength of the fighter is the damage they deal to the enemy, and the health points is how much damage they can take before being destroyed. If there are no opposing cards on the same lane, the enemy Hero is attacked.
  • Tricks are cards that directly affect the game by damaging or healing Fighters or Heroes, summoning or destroying Fighters, adding or removing strength or health, ect. If on the zombies side, they can only be played on the third phase of the turn. If on the plants side, they can be deployed during their phase. The only attribute associated with them is their Cost (SunPvZH/BrainPvZH).
    • Superpowers are a powerful tribe of trick cards that cost 1 brain/sun each. One is given at the start of each game and you can only gain more by getting a Super-Block. There are four Superpowers in a deck: 3 regular ones that are each shared by two heroes, and 1 Signature Superpower, an exceptionally powerful move that is exclusive to the Hero.

Each hero has 20 points of health plus a Super-Block Meter. When damage is suffered, the Super-Block Meter will fill up randomly 1-3 blocks where a shield consists of 10 blocks. When the Mega-Block charger becomes full, the Hero will block the attack, and receive a superpower that can be saved or deployed immediately for free. Each Hero can block attacks a total of 3 times per game. Each time the Hero blocks, one shield below meter will disappear.

During a game, each turn has four phases.

  • The first one is the Zombies Play phase, where the Zombie Hero can summon zombie Fighters;
  • The second one is the Plants Play phase, where the Plant Hero can plant both Plant Tricks and Fighters;
  • The third one is the Zombie Tricks phase, where the Zombie Hero can only play Zombie Tricks;
  • And the last one is the battle phase, where each card played battle from left to the right, so Fighters on the leftmost lane attack first and the Fighters on the rightmost lane attack last.

At the start of each turn, the total amount of sun/brains received from the last turn plus one is given, allowing that the more powerful cards are only played later on the game, so the player must not only rely on them otherwise they have nothing to play on the first turns.
Each deck needs to have exactly 40 cards shared between tricks and plants/zombies. Additionally each hero has Superpowers which can't be changed and doesn't count towards the limit. It is allowed to have up to 4 copies of each card, and they are separated in basic and premium, followed by their rarity. Only 10 cards can be in your hand at once, if you already have ten cards in your hand, you cannot draw more. However, it is possible to have more than ten cards in your hand through the Bounce effect.
Basic cards are purchased at the store using coins that are earned after battle (15 after winning in a mission, 10 for winning a casual match, 20 for winning a ranked match, 100 after winning a boss battle, 5 after failure and zero for friendly match.). Premium cards are only obtained at the store though Premium Packs or a free pack by losing a battle multiple times (normally 4), and their rarity means the chances of obtaining them via packs is low unless there is a limited time offer that offers specific cards.

Heroes

Heroes are the main playable characters in Plants vs. Zombies Heroes, and the ones required to be defeated so the game can end.
Heroes have unique Superpowers, Tricks, Classes and cards who they can lead, making each one different from the others.
At the end of each mission there is a Boss Battle against one of the Heroes.That hero always appears in the corner of a mission's screen. These battles have a special gimmick (like a change on the number of cards given, increased or decreased health or pre-summoned Fighters) that can have a powerful effect on the required playstyle. Starting from Mission 21 from each side, the third battle or Crisis Battle will also have a special gimmick.

Each mission consists of five stages, the Encounter Battle, a regular battle against the main opposing hero, the Teammate Battle 1, against a different hero, the Mini-Boss Battle, which has a gimmick in the later missions, the Teammate Battle 2, against yet another different hero, and finally, the Boss Battle, which has a strong gimmick against the main opposing hero.

Classes

Each hero leads two different classes which have different types of attacks and traits.

Plants

Class Icon Description
Guardian PvZH Guardian Icon They defensively Team-Up, are Armored, and Amphibious!
Kabloom PvZH Kabloom Icon They are EXPLOSIVE and swarming, doing extra damage!
Mega Grow PvZH Mega-Grow Icon They make Plants HUGE and give Bonus Attacks!
Smarty PvZH Smarty Icon They outsmart foes with Bounce, Freeze, and Amphibious!
Solar PvZH Solar Icon They make extra Sun, Heal, and then Strikethrough the enemy!

Zombies

Class Icon Description
Beastly PvZH Beastly Icon They grow large, Frenzy, and will destroy the enemy.
Brainy PvZH Brainy Icon They are Tricky, gain extra Brains, and use Bullseye!
Crazy PvZH Crazy Icon They are aggressive dancers, and do damage directly!
Hearty PvZH Hearty Icon They outlast using high health, Armored, and Healing!
Sneaky PvZH Sneaky Icon They avoid fighting by moving, being Amphibious, and hiding in Gravestones!

Special effects

  • Afterlife - When the zombie is defeated, it can be played again. Zombies like the Haunting Zombie or the Octo Zombie must be defeated twice before getting destroyed.
  • PvZH Anti-Hero Icon Anti-Hero - Does more damage when attacking the enemy Hero. Extra Strength equivalent to Anti-Hero value.
  • PvZH Armored Icon Armored - Reduces damage from attacks equal to its Armored value. Can reduce damage to 0.
  • Amphibious - Can be placed in water lanes.
  • Bounce - Bounces the target plant/zombie back into the player's hand. It can be played again.
  • PvZH Truestrike Icon Bullseye - Does not charge the Super-Block Meter if a successful hit is landed on the enemy Hero.
  • PvZH Deadly Icon Deadly - Automatically kills the damaged plant after battling. Only Zombies in Sneaky class have this ability. There are 3 zombies with this trait in-game.
  • Extra Sun/Brains - Gives extra Sun/Brains to the player.
  • Extra Stats - Increases Strength/Health by given values during the first turn played.
  • PvZH Frozen Icon Freeze - Frozen enemy skips its next attack.
  • PvZH Frenzy Icon Frenzy - Does a bonus attack if it defeats a plant.
  • Gravestone - Hides under a Gravestone until the Zombie Tricks phase. Any "When played" abilities happen at the beginning of the Zombie Tricks phase. Can be prematurely destroyed before any effects take place with Grave Buster. Can heal zombie in it if using a trick. Only Zombies have this ability.
  • Can't be hurt - Cannot take damage from battle this turn.
  • Splash - Deals damage to enemies next door. Splash Strength is Splash value. Only Plants have this ability.
  • PvZH Strikethrough Icon Strikethrough - Penetrates multiple foes to deal damage to the Hero and all other enemies in the way. There are 4 plants and 3 zombies with this trait in-game.
  • Team-Up - Can be placed in front or behind another teammate, or a teammate can be placed in front of or behind itself. Only Plants have this ability.

Trivia

  • It appears that the art style for this game was originally meant to be the one in Plants vs. Zombies Adventures, as shown on a beta gameplay photo, but ultimately took on a more toonish art style resembling the one from Plants vs. Zombies 2.
  • The icon of the 1.0.11 update marks the first time where a plant (Green Shadow) is featured on the game's icon instead of a zombie.
  • As noted by the official website and game description game wise, this is the third mobile game and mode where you can play as both the plants and zombies after Plants vs. Zombies and the Chinese version of Plants vs. Zombies 2.
  • Plants vs. Zombies Heroes is the only mobile Plants vs. Zombies game to be played vertically.
  • Whenever a Legendary teammate is placed on the field, the opposing Hero will have a shocked or surprised animation different from their hurt or worried animation.
  • All the new playable characters on Plants vs. Zombies: Garden Warfare 2 appear on this game as heroes, with the exception of Kernel Corn and Captain Deadbeard, who are legendary teammates.
